Heck, if you do self-disembarkation you can make the 10:30 flight, if one is available.:classic_biggrin:  Airport is about 15-20 minutes from port.  Also, on our Feb. Symphony sail, Miami was using Facial Recognition Technology and the process is extremely efficient.  No passport or forms to show/declare.
